Nuabandha
Nuabandha is a village located in Badamba tehsil of Cuttack district in Odisha,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Badamba (tehsildar office) and 100km away from district headquarter Cuttack. As per 2009 stats, Jodumu is the gram panchayat of Nuabandha village.

About Nuabandha
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Nuabandha is 398814. The village spans a total geographical area of 40 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 754031. Cuttack is nearest town to Nuabandha village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 100km away.

Population of Nuabandha
According to the 2011 Census, Nuabandha has a total population of about 570, with approximately 286 males and 284 females. The sex ratio is around 993 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 70 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 47 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 76.14%, with male literacy at about 82.17% and female literacy near 70.07%. There are around 146 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 570 | 286 | 284 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 70 | 32 | 38 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 47 | 25 | 22 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 434 | 235 | 199 |
Illiterate Population | 136 | 51 | 85 |
Connectivity of Nuabandha
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Nuabandha. As per the 2011 stats, Nuabandha had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
